Amir Reza Khadem

Amir Reza Khadem Azghadi (Persian: امیررضا خادم ازغدی, born 10 February 1970) is an Iranian wrestler who won Olympic bronze medals in 1992 and 1996. He finished fourth at the 2000 Summer Olympics, and he won the 1991 World Championships, He also won a bronze medal at the 1990 World Championships and the 1992 and 1993 Asian Championships and a silver medal at the 1991 Asian Championships and the 1994 Asian Games.

He was trained by his father Mohammad Khadem. His younger brother Rasoul Khadem is also a world champion and an Olympic gold medalist in freestyle wrestling.

He is currently Vice Minister of Youth Affairs and Sports in Legal, Parliamentary and Provincial Affairs, has been appointed for the position on 30 December 2013.
